At a glance
SVG Support leads the WordPress.org popular list today at #48, ahead of a3 Lazy Load at #493. Over the last 7 days SVG Support climbed 1 place and a3 Lazy Load climbed 1 place. SVG Support has the largest install base, roughly 11× the next: 1M+ active installs against 90K+ for a3 Lazy Load. Downloads this week: SVG Support 33,810 and a3 Lazy Load 2,311. Ratings: a3 Lazy Load 4.3★ from 148 and SVG Support 4.8★ from 356 reviews.

Where do these numbers come from?
WordPress.org publishes each plugin’s active install count and its position on the popular list. This site records both every day, along with per-day downloads and ratings, so the charts above show how the plugins have moved over time rather than a single day.
